'No-Till seed drills are useful for planting seeds in the ground to develop a white-tailed deer food plot. Main advantage is planting seeds without disturbing the soil.  Also used in prairie restoration and comes in many sizes.  Larry Pierce of Texas A&M AgriLife Extension Service and C.S. Johnston explain (Video 12 of 12)'
